On Thu, Sep 11, 2008 at 11:51:32AM +0000, Jarek Poplawski wrote:
IMHO, the most reasonable test here is for all tx_queues of a qdisc beeing stopped, but since this is quite heavy, probably we need an additional qdisc flag for such an occasion.
Yes we could do that too. Although the head-of-qdisc approach will eventually lead to the same result. That is, as you pop things off the head eventually you'll hit a packet that belongs to the stopped queue and that'll then block the whole qdisc. So I don't think there's anything inherently advantageous in checking all the queues.
